    Re: CNC Router machined 1911 pistol frame

    Several of the holes are for locating dowel pins. For example, below is how the piece will be oriented for the Magwell machining operation.

    The magazine well and the hole for the disconnector need to be machined at an off angle. The disconnector hole is a bit tricky since I am drilling into an angled surface. I use a flat end mill to just kiss the surface and make a little flat area that I can then use a spot drill, then an actual drill to precisely place the hole. If you try to spot or drill in a slanted surface the drill will walk down hill before it bites.

    In the first picture you will notice an Ohm meter. I connect one lead to the work piece and the other to the router body. My meter has a buzzer that lets you know when you have continuity, I use this to zero my mills to the work piece or the locator dowel pins. this is how I can precisely align my machining operation to the part, switch tools and repeat.
